Description
South Carolina-based journalist Issac J. Bailey reflects on a wide range of complex, divisive topics -- from police brutality and Confederate symbols to respectability politics and white discomfort -- which have taken on a fresh urgency with the protest movement sparked by George Floyd's killing.
